The Company and Core Values

At Alexander Timber Designs, we bring expert craftsmanship and creative passion to every project—delivering high-end timberwork at fair prices. Our commitment to quality starts with using locally sourced timber from Larch Hills, partnering with skilled local tradespeople, and repurposing onsite or reclaimed materials whenever possible.
​We believe in building stronger communities, not just structures. That’s why we buy local, volunteer local, and stay local.

The Owner/Builder

At Alexander Timber Designs, every project is built with skill, precision, and a passion for craftsmanship. Led by Michael, a Red Seal Carpenter with extensive experience across residential, commercial, industrial, timber framing, and log home building, we specialize in heavy timber joinery for homes and community spaces.
​
With a career spanning high-end projects across Canada and England, Michael has honed his craft under the mentorship of world-class experts in traditional masonry, hard landscaping, and timber framing. His expertise ensures each structure is aesthetically refined, structurally sound, and built to last.
​
Guided by a deep appreciation for quality, longevity, and site-specific design, Michael blends creativity with technical excellence. Every project is crafted with strict tolerances, high aesthetic value, and a commitment to cutting no corners—delivering timber structures that stand the test of time.

Volunteering and Partnerships

Giving back has always been a core value for Michael. From an early age, he has been deeply involved in his community—whether building trails in his hometown or serving as a trumpeter for 15 years at Remembrance Day services.
​Wherever Michael has lived, he has contributed his time and skills to local initiatives, including the Macauly Mountain Conservation, Calgary Folk Festival, Roots and Blues Folk Festival, and Gardom Lake Community Park, among others.
​
Now, through Alexander Timber Designs, Michael continues his commitment to community support by partnering with the Enderby Seniors Community, donating two days each month to assist with projects that enhance the lives of local seniors. As the company grows, new partnerships and volunteer initiatives will be integrated into its regular operations—ensuring that craftsmanship and community go hand in hand.
